Nature's Wonderland has this whimsical yet slightly eerie quality. The animation style melds classic Disney charm with a hint of nostalgia, giving it a unique vibe that’s different from typical releases. The pacing is relaxed, allowing you to settle into the enchanting landscapes, though it does veer into a sense of urgency when Mickey and Minnie get lost. The practical effects, especially in depicting the Rainbow Caverns, really stand out, bringing a tactile feel to the animated world. Performances by the characters carry that classic Disney spirit, evoking a sense of wonder and adventure that feels timeless. It's distinct in its exploration of nature and friendship, creating a delightful escapade that lingers in your memory.
Nature's Wonderland is an interesting piece for collectors, particularly because of its limited release and the mysterious nature of its production. While not extensively documented, the film has attracted attention for its unusual blend of styles and themes, making it somewhat of a curiosity in Disney's animated lineup. Its scarcity in physical formats adds to its allure, and there's a growing interest among collectors who appreciate the niche aspects of Disney's less mainstream offerings.
